Double Glazed Window Replacement

Double-glazed windows are a cost-effective and efficient method of protect a home from the elements. However, they can develop moisture between the panes, causing them to mist. This is usually due to damaged window seals.

doorpanels-300x200.jpg?A professional will need to replace the window glass to solve this problem. Replacement of double-glazed windows is an undertaking that requires attention to detail as well as accurate measurements. This job should only be performed by a professional.

Noise reduction

Double glazing does not just keep heat out but also reduces unwanted sound. It does this by creating two obstacles for sound to pass through instead of one. The first obstacle is the gap between the window frames, and the second is the air between them. This combination of obstacles makes it much difficult for the sound to penetrate your home and ensures the peace and quiet that you are entitled to.

A double-glazed windows consists of two panes of glass with a gap that's filled with air or an inert gas like argon to act as an insulation. The glass and frame are sealed to create an airtight device that's designed to minimize energy loss and noise transmission.
